WebBest. KennKanifff • 2 yr. ago. If you don't have a modded GC, you could use a modded Wii to make an exploit memory card loaded with GBI (Game Boy Interface) and run it on any stock gamecube. I've used this to run GB on my wife's GC (she has the player, but apparently never owned the disc). There are tutorials online. 3. WebApr 24, 2008 · 11. If you are downloading a game make sure the file size is 1.35gb otherwise it is an incorrect file. Also, ensure that it is an iso file. If all this info is correct then use Nero to burn it onto a disc. I use Verbatum printable mini discs and I never have a problem with them.
